Holiday timing and how BBQ fits

Holiday celebrations number up on Thursdays and Fridays between the very first week of December and the weekend prior to New Year's. Company food catering often tends to skew earlier in the month, while family and community events pack the center. That concentration strains rental supplies, staffing rosters, and leading smoker capability throughout the region. Excellent barbeque is not an eleventh hour sporting activity. Brisket takes 12 to 16 hours at reduced warm, drew pork typically the same, et cetera of the prep accumulates behind those chef times.

Lead time affects greater than the cook. In Albany workplace towers, you require constructing approval for distributions after 5 p.m. And elevator accessibility for warm boxes. In Schenectady's older locations, a couple of entrances are narrow, so full size warmers do not constantly fit. Niskayuna neighborhood areas commonly secure at specific times. Knowing those quirks early makes the evening run smoothly.

BBQ works for wintertime since a vapor table at 160 to 180 levels keeps chopped turkey or drew pork tender instead of drying. Beans and collards only improve as they rest. With the best chafers and fuel, you can offer for two hours without quality sliding. For plated solution that would certainly be a battle; for buffet catering, it is a strength.

Buffet flow that keeps lines short

Most vacation occasions in the BBQ catering services Schenectady Capital Region being in the 60 to 180 visitor range. A single buffet line can relocate 75 to 100 guests in 20 to thirty minutes if you prepare the order easily: plates initially, healthy proteins, sides, sauces, bread, after that tools and paper napkins at the end so visitors can hold their plate with 2 hands until the last step. Increased or mirrored lines are clever once you cross 120 visitors. Place drinks across the space from the food to keep web traffic from converging.

I remember a corporate event in midtown Albany, regarding 150 individuals, where we established 2 mirrored buffets and a carving terminal for smoked turkey breast near bench. Each line had a dedicated attendant to slice brisket in genuine time, which managed parts and maintained turnover brisk. We positioned the sauce bar in between both lines to share it successfully. The lengthiest anyone waited was 7 mins. That tiny design choice kept the energy up and let the CFO coating statements prior to dessert.

Chafers matter greater than signs. Full dimension, deep frying pans are excellent for beans and mac and cheese. Superficial frying pans and frequent refills maintain chopped brisket juicy. If your caterer supplies smoked meat providing frequently, they will certainly discuss half pans inside complete water frying pans, not due to the fact that it sounds technological, yet because it protects against the outer sides from overcooking throughout service. Anticipate a couple of gas cylinders per chafer for a 2 hour service. If the venue does not permit open fire, prepare for electrical warming with dedicated 20 amp circuits and cord covers to avoid journey hazards.

Menus that traveling and please

December menus desire a nod to the season. At the same time, classic barbecue hits are still the anchor. In Albany providing conversations, brisket and drew pork are the most requested, with smoked turkey a close third once the calendar turns to wintertime. Ribs are precious however decrease the line due to bones and sauce. They beam at smaller events where visitors can sit, not stand.

If you are stabilizing a group with mixed tastes, select two meats and 2 to 3 sides. That is generally sufficient range without stressing the budget. For a 100 individual celebration, calculate regarding 6 to 8 ounces of cooked healthy protein per guest, total across the meats, with a slight padding if you know the team leans hearty. Aim for 4 to 6 ounces per side, and remember that mac and cheese will certainly always go quicker than you expect. Give one and a fifty percent buns each for drawn things, and think about mini rolls for a slider choice that minimizes waste.

Holiday leaning sides in the Capital Region commonly include baked Brussels sprouts with bacon, BBQ caterer in Schenectady sweet potato mash with maple, and cranberry slaw that adds illumination to abundant meats. Criterion barbecue sides like collards, pit beans, cornbread, and mac and cheese are sure things year round. A winter season salad with citrus or pickled onions cuts through the smoke and keeps the plate from transforming grayscale. If you want a showpiece, a glazed smoked ham sculpted to purchase releases the vacation vibe without dragging the line the means rib shelfs do.

Sauce range lets guests build flavor without unique orders. Offer at the very least two: a tomato molasses home sauce and a tasty vinegar sauce for pulled pork. Add a mustard sauce if you wish to nod towards Carolina style. Keep at least one sauce without gluten or milk. Tag everything plainly. In cool areas, maintain sauces cozy yet not warm to avoid skinning over.

For dessert, banana pudding really feels right with barbeque, but December begs for pecan pie bars, gingerbread, or apple crisp. If you offer hefty sides, select lighter desserts. If the food selection leans leaner with turkey and slaw, you can bring out the pecan bars and no one will complain.

Service design, from decline off to full crew

The best level of solution depends on the occasion's objectives and the location's rules. A tiny office celebration in Colonie could need leave only, while a corporate vacation gala at Proctors in Schenectady will certainly want full service catering.

Here is a quick comparison to frame the option:

  • Drop off buffet: Finest for 20 to 60 guests secretive rooms. Includes non reusable chafers, classified pans, and sauces. Budget plan friendly, very little staffing. You manage refills and breakdown.
  • Attended buffet: Adds a couple of staff to manage the line, piece meats, and keep food risk-free. Great for 60 to 150 guests. Reduces portion control and cleanliness.
  • Full service food catering: A complete team establishes the area, collaborates rentals, staffs several stations, takes care of drink solution, and deals with cleaning. Best for 100 plus guests or venues with strict timelines.
  • Action station add ons: Carving or mac and cheese bars staffed by a cook. Creates cinema, controls pace, and helps visitors personalize without blocking the main line.

As a guideline, prepare for one buffet consequent per 25 to 35 visitors when slicing or plating meats on the line. Include drifting staff to clear tables if you are not making use of disposables. For bar service, one bartender per 50 to 75 guests maintains lines sane, with more if the menu skews toward cocktails.

Holiday details constraints in the Capital Region

Weather remains on the essential course. Snow or freezing rain can add 15 to 40 minutes to delivery timelines throughout Albany and Schenectady. Develop a barrier right into your timetable. Excellent event catering groups pad transit, lug additional cambros, and utilize high warm loads to keep frying pans within food secure arrays even if a rake blocks a street for a bit.

Some locations limit open flame, which impacts chafers. Downtown Albany buildings and a couple of Schenectady museums require electrical warmers. If that is the case, ask your catering service to bring distribution cables, gaff tape for security, and power strips with built in breakers. Tag circuits, especially in older structures where electrical outlets share tons with lighting.

Smokers on site are charming, but not constantly sensible in winter months. Wind and lake effect gusts near the Mohawk can go down pit temperature levels and risk service schedules. When a customer insists on on site smoking at a Clifton Park stockroom, we established the smoker inside a box truck with the door split, fans set to tire, and a wireless probe sending temperatures to the kitchen table. It worked, but the backup strategy was fully cooked meat in hot boxes parked 10 feet away. Unless your place has a covered loading area and the event lasts all the time, on site smoking is better in Might than December.

Ventilation issues inside. Smoked meats launch aromas that people love, yet if you are slicing warm brisket right next to a layer rack, you will certainly fragrance every topcoat in the building. Set sculpting near a doorway or under a hood where feasible. If the area is small, think about pre cutting and keeping in jus to lessen steam.

Dietary demands without hindering the buffet

No holiday party in the Capital Region is entirely meat and dairy these days. Number on 10 to 20 percent of visitors seeking a vegetarian, vegan, or gluten free plate. Good barbecue menus can suit that without turning into a second event.

Offer at the very least one plant heavy side that eats like a meal. Smoked mushroom and farro pilaf, baked root vegetables with natural herbs, or black eyed peas with eco-friendlies are pleasing. Maintain collards devoid of pork and deal bacon bits on the side. Make certain one sauce is without gluten and dairy products. Label nuts in desserts clearly, and maintain the nut based sugary foods far from the major buffet so any person with a major allergy can stay clear of cross get in touch with. Give gluten totally free rolls on a separate tray, covered until opened, with its very own tongs. If you include fried items, confirm whether the fryer is committed or shared.

For a recent Niskayuna event catering, a 90 individual charity event in a church hall, the host anticipated 5 vegetarians and 2 gluten totally free guests. We brought a tray of smoked jackfruit with a vinegar sauce, baked it off with onions, and served on gluten cost-free rolls. The major line was brisket, turkey, mac and cheese, beans, and slaw. The jackfruit went faster than expected since omnivores were curious. It is a pointer to pad plant based counts by a few parts. Curiosity is real.

Portion preparation and waste control

Holiday cravings differ. Early afternoon family events see lighter plates than 7 p.m. Corporate parties. You can tighten quotes by asking three questions: time of day, will there be heavy appetizers prior to supper, and for how long is service intended. For a one hour lunch solution without an alcoholic drink hour, 6 ounces of protein each holds. For a night with an open bar and a two hour buffet window, strategy 7 to 8 ounces.

For ribs, count by bone. 3 to four bones per person works as a supplement to various other meats. For chicken, bone in thighs and drumsticks count as one piece per person if mixed with various other proteins. For pulled products, sauce lightly before the line to keep wetness, then use more sauce on the side. Light pre saucing keeps healthy proteins glossy on the buffet and lowers waste, because visitors do not drown sliders they barely finish.

Use smaller spoons in sides that often tend to go out early, like mac and cheese. It slows the first wave just sufficient to extend pans up until you can swap in refills. If sustainability is a priority, compostable service ware is commonly readily available in your area, yet true composting choices are restricted unless the location partners with a hauler. If that is not in place, heavy duty reusable melamine plates and stainless tableware rent well and decrease garbage volume noticeably.

Budget arrays and where the cash goes

Capital Region pricing differs by menu, service degree, and day, but some varieties hold. For a decrease off barbecue buffet with two meats, two sides, buns, sauces, and disposables, expect approximately 18 to 26 dollars each for groups of 50 or even more. Add personnel for an attended buffet and the variety relocates to 24 to 35 dollars per person, depending upon head count and staffing ratios. Full service catering with rentals, bartenders, and treat can land between 35 and 55 dollars per person, even more if you add exceptional healthy proteins like ribs and brisket for the whole group.

Holiday Fridays carry a small premium because labor is limited and need is high. Ribs and brisket expense even more to generate than drew pork or turkey, not just in raw product, but in smoker time and trim loss. Sides like mac and cheese and collards are cost-effective, while Brussels sprouts and specialty salads bring a greater cost per serving in winter months. Delivery within Albany and Schenectady correct is normally consisted of at certain limits, with modest fees for farther drives across the Resources Region.

Packaging, transportation, and food security in the cold

In winter season, safe holding is about 2 extremes: keeping hot food over 140 levels and cool food below 40 levels. The ambient temperature level in a loading dock assists with the chilly, not the hot. Dual wrap hot frying pans with aluminum foil, transportation in protected carriers, and open cambros just when needed. At the location, chafers or warmers must be full and steaming prior to pans drop in. Keep an electronic thermostat accessible. Quick checks protect against guesswork.

Cold salads ride in different coolers with ice blankets. Put them out later, not at initial setup, if the service window is long. Place sauce mugs on a cooled tray if they sit near a fire place or heating unit. It is a small step, however it maintains the line looking cool 2 hours right into the party.
